タグ

chatworkとqiitaに関するnabinnoのブックマーク (4)

  • hubotとchatworkを連携して定常作業を自動化した話 - Qiita

    マイネット Advent Calender14日目の記事です。 はじめに 弊社ではスマートフォンゲームの運営を行っておりますが、 日々の運用で定常的に発生する作業があります。 定常作業の例 複数プラットフォームの毎日の売上などの情報を管理サイトから引っ張ってきて足し合わせる ○月△日 □時になったら管理サイトで集計を行う etc... いずれも作業としては単純ですが、手動で行うと面倒なだけではなく、ミスの原因にもなります。 これらの作業はたいてい単純作業ですが、作業をエンジニアしか行うことが出来ない場合があり、非効率なこともあります。 また、自動化の方法はいくらでもありますが、弊社の特徴として買収・協業を行っているタイトルがあり、その中には以下のような制限が存在することもあります。 sudoが使えない(権限がない、cron仕込めない、ツールも入れられない) 勝手にAPIとか追加できない そ

    hubotとchatworkを連携して定常作業を自動化した話 - Qiita
  • ChatworkAPIにexpressからrequestモジュールで接続 - Qiita

    やっと利用申請していたチャットワークAPIの利用許可がおりました!! ので、実際に使ってみます。 チャットワークAPI このAPIは自分史上初めてのタイプでheaderにtokenをセットして送信することでGETやPOSTで値を取れます。 サンプルリクエスト サンプルリクエストのcurlコマンドに -Hオプションでヘッダー情報を送っているのが分かります。 $ curl -X GET -H "X-ChatWorkToken: YOUR API KEY" "https://api.chatwork.com/v1/rooms" "X-ChatWorkToken: YOUR API KEY"という形でAPI KEYを渡します。 node.jsから接続したらconnect ECONNREFUSEDってエラー http.request()やhttp.get()で上手く接続出来ませんでした汗 このエラー

    ChatworkAPIにexpressからrequestモジュールで接続 - Qiita
  • ElectronでChatworkをデスクトップアプリ化 (Webview + badge) - Qiita

    electronが流行っているみたいなので、触ってみたかった。 テスト期間が辛くてコードを書きたくなったので、簡単なアプリを書いてみた。 つくるもの electronでデスクトップアプリ風のChatworkを作成する。 webviewでChatworkを表示 自分に付いた未読のメンション数をバッジで表示する この2点を満たすのが、今回のゴール。 環境 MacOS X 10.10.4 Node.js v.0.12.4 electron v.0.30.0 やってみる electronのセットアップとHelloWorld 以下の記事を参考にしてelectronでhello worldします。 30分で出来る、JavaScript (Electron) でデスクトップアプリを作って配布するまで

    ElectronでChatworkをデスクトップアプリ化 (Webview + badge) - Qiita
  • Hubotからテレビの電源を入れる。 (IRKit入門) - Qiita

    IRKITが手元にあるので使ってみた感じのメモです。 Chatwork/Hubot->(milkcocoa)->ローカルマシン->(curl/HTTP)->IRKit->(赤外線)->テレビ という連携をしてみました。 はじめに IRKitは赤外線の信号を記憶して、自由に発信することが出来るガジェットです。公式サイトの説明はこんな感じです。 IRKitは、 公式のリモコンアプリ IRKitシンプルリモコン から操作できるほか、 IRKit iOS-SDK を使えば、 任意のタイミングで赤外線信号を送ることのできるiOSアプリを簡単につくることができます。 また、JavaScriptを使ってブラウザから赤外線信号を送ったり curlを使って黒い画面(Terminal)から赤外線信号を送ることもできます。 IRKitデバイス自体にHTTPサーバがあり、 JSON形式の赤外線情報を HTTP P

    Hubotからテレビの電源を入れる。 (IRKit入門) - Qiita
  • 1